广义互斥约束的Petri网死锁避免监控器设计
Design of Supervisor of Petri Nets Based on Generalized Mutual Exclusion Constraints作者机构:南京航空航天大学自动化学院南京210016 东南大学电子信息工程学院南京211189
出 版 物:《农业机械学报》 (Transactions of the Chinese Society for Agricultural Machinery)
年 卷 期:2015年第46卷第8期
页 面:327-332页
核心收录:
学科分类:12[管理学] 1201[管理学-管理科学与工程(可授管理学、工学学位)] 08[工学] 0835[工学-软件工程] 081201[工学-计算机系统结构] 081202[工学-计算机软件与理论] 0812[工学-计算机科学与技术(可授工学、理学学位)]
基 金:国家自然科学基金资助项目(61473144) 南京航空航天大学专项资助项目(NS2010069)
摘 要:研究了Petri网的柔性制造加工系统中的死锁避免问题。为了保证死锁避免和资源最大允许利用,提出了基于广义互斥约束的Petri网最优监控器的设计方法,探寻以线性不等式的形式表示的初步约束集,通过可达性分析和初步约束集建立可达树得出合法标识集和死锁标识集,对分离出的标识建立混合整数线性规划模型,运用分支定界法得到补充监控库所的广义互斥约束模型作为最优监控器。最后,以某柔性制造系统为例,建立了Petri网模型,结合零件加工过程中资源的占用和释放,对柔性制造系统进行控制器设计,设计的控制器拥有更严格的约束和更简化的模型,对死锁标识的避免是充分的,验证了该算法的有效性。